If Northside was feeling good fresh off their 10-0 takedown of Jonesboro last Friday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. Northside came up short against the Starr's Mill Panthers on Tuesday, falling 5-0. Northside were red-hot offensively heading into the game (they scored no less than four goals in the three matchups prior), but Starr's Mill's defense proved too tough.
Northside's loss ended an eight-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 9-3. As for Starr's Mill,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won six of their last seven cont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 7-5 record this season.
Northside will host Newnan at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. Northside's defense better be ready for this one: Newnan has averaged an impressive 6.9 goals per game this season. As for Starr's Mill, a feisty cat fight will be fought as Starr's Mill take on Jonesboro at 6:00 p.m. on Friday.
